brazen

     adj 1: unrestrained by convention or propriety; "an audacious trick
            to pull"; "a barefaced hypocrite"; "the most bodacious
            display of tourism this side of Anaheim"- Los Angeles
            Times; "bold-faced lies"; "brazen arrogance"; "the
            modern world with its quick material successes and
            insolent belief in the boundless possibilities of
            progress"- Bertrand Russell [syn: audacious, barefaced,
             bodacious, bold-faced, brassy, brazen-faced,
            insolent]
     2: made of or resembling brass (as in color or hardness)
     v :  face with defiance or impudence; "brazen it out"
